Vodafone India  (Hutch) has introduced the Blackberry 8310 and Blackberry 8820 priced at Rs.24,990 and Rs.31,990

Vodafone acquired Hong Kong-based Hutchison International’s Indian telecom arm Hutch’s stake for $11.1 billion in May this year. The company earlier said it would be investing $2 billion in consolidating and expanding its business in the country.

Vodafone Essar, India’s second largest mobile service operator after Airtel, has a subscriber base of 34.11 million and a market share of 20.11 percent as on Aug 31, 2007, according to data released by the Cellular Operators Association of India (COAI).

Fly enters low cost handset market with V70 and M110

Meridian Mobile – A major player in the telecom (mobile handset) industry are pleased to announce the launch of low cost phones in Indian market under the Fly brand. 

‘Fly’ a much sought after brand in the Central Europe market is now creating ripples not only in India but also in Germany, Spain and south Asian markets. 

Fly currently has a range of 18 models in the Indian market. All the models are feature packed mid-segment phones. The latest to join the Fly family are the V70 & M110. This takes the number of currently running models to 20. 

The V70 & M110 marks the entry of Fly in to the low priced segment. While the phones are reasonably priced, they still flaunt best in class features & stunning looks.

V70 – Candy Bar Phone 

V 70 frontA smart Candy Bar phone displaying simplicity at its best. It exhibits a lively combination of entertaining features at extremely reasonable prices. This light weight phone offers the most hunted features like MP3 ring tones and USB connect. It has a lot to do with the music lovers as it offers radio FM facility with built in antenna. It also has a 4x zoom VGA Camera for soft clicks and offers a satisfying storage capacity of 500 in phonebook and up to 200 messages. It gives a battery back up of 2 hours and 30 minutes of talk time and remarkable 120 hours at standby mode.

This phone is priced at Rs.3250/-

M110 – Clamshell Phone

M110A Cute Clamshell mobile fulfilling all the basic requirements with its quality features. It can be connected with the PC sync via USB. It is a high on storage phone with a storage memory of 500 in the phonebook and up to 200 messages.  The VGA Camera it offers facilitates the user with 4x Zoom. Enjoy foot tapping music and your favourite numbers every time your phone rings with MP3 ring tones. All these exiting features are available at most reasonable price.

This phone is priced at Rs.3150/-

The new Nokia E51 , E50 gets a major upgrade

Nokia today announced a new member to it E series of phones – the Nokia E51 .

The E Series phones are targeted at business and enterprise user.

The E51 is a sequel to the E50.

Its just 12mm thick but has Wlan ,Bluetooth 2.0 EDR, microSD expansion

Network features include GSM Quad band support, 3G, HSPDA, GPRS and EDGE

Nokia e51

It sports a 2 Mega pixel Camera also.

Other highlights include FM Radio and Music Player.

The E51 is set to hit the stores in October or November and will retail at about EUR 350 or Rs.20,000 in India.

Vodafone India will replace Hutch from September 20

The Hutch pug and the Hutch pink will soon not be seen on Indian screens and hoardings as Vodafone is going to roll out its Global branding in India from September.

Arun Sarin, CEO of Vodafone will unleash the Vodafone logo later this week in India

Vodafone has made bulk bookings on Star and Sony Television for airing the new Ads.

BPL Mobile Tracker – SMS based lost phone watchdog

Being a mobile phone blog we get numerous requests from desperate users who have just lost their phones. Sadly we cant help.

BPL Mobile has come up with an interesting Mobile Tracker solution which sends out an SMS when the SIM Card on your mobile phone is changed. The software works only on some GSM / Nokia Symbian handsets which include

India beats USA to emerge as the second largest market for Nokia

Nokia India is now the second largest market for the Finnish Mobile phone Maker.

China continues to be the no.1 . USA was at no.1 and is now moved to no.2

Nokia CEO Olli-Pekka Kallasvuo is in India  for meeting some goverment officials .

Nokia Chennai’s Sriperumbudur plant has produced 60 Million handsets so far and about 50 % of them have been exported to over 58 countries

Nokia India brand image under attack

The brand image for Nokia India is under serious threat due to the recent Nokia battery recall which we had covered last week.

nokia-india.battery.jpg

The company even made a status check possible via SMS to 5555 with the BT <26 digit battery no>.

But panic struck people are thronging Nokia service centers and dealers to check the status of their battery.

About 4-5 % of phones in India are affected according to IntoMobile

Airtel, Hutch and other operators are co-operating with Nokia according to HT

Nokia CEO, Olli-Pekka Kallasvuo is going to be in India on Aug 22-24 . May be to have a idea of ground level situation in the country.

Nokia opens its design studio in India

Nokia has partnered with Srishti School of Art, Design and Technology, Bangalore, India for the first of its kind design studio in India.Nokia has picked India as a starting point for a series of satellite design studios it plans to establish in design hot spots around the world, signaling the increasing impact the country is having on the development of mobile phones. Established via a two year partnership with the Srishti School of Art, Design and Technology in Bangalore, it will give Nokia designers and India’s talented young designers the opportunity to work together on new design ideas for India and the global markets.

Alastair Curtis, Nokia’s Chief Designer and Ms. Geetha Narayanan, Founder & Director, Srishti has issued a joint press release today.
